History
Est. 1953
Founded in 1953, Reno National Little League is one of Nevada's longest-running youth baseball programs. For over 70 seasons, RNLL has given children throughout the Reno area the opportunity to play ball, make friends, and grow as athletes and teammates.
Home base has always been Swope Fields at 901 Keele Drive — a landmark of Reno youth sports. From T-ball to Majors to Softball, generations of Reno families have cheered from those bleachers.
RNLL is a chartered member of Little League International, the world's largest organized youth sports program. That affiliation means our programs follow proven player-development standards while keeping the game fun and accessible for every kid.

Inclusion
Challenger Division
The Challenger Division is Little League's adaptive baseball program for players with physical and mental disabilities, ages 4–18. Every player gets the chance to bat, run the bases, and play in the field — with the help of volunteer buddies when needed.
Reno National Little League proudly operates a local Challenger program. Games use modified rules to ensure safe, meaningful participation for all ability levels. The focus is on fun, confidence, and community — every achievement is celebrated.
